#2f895f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f895f is composed of 18.4% red, 53.7%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 152 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 36.1%. #2f895f color hex could be obtained by blending #5effbe with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2f895f color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.

#2f895f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2f895f has RGB values of R:47, G:137,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3115359.

Shades and Tints of #2f895f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020604 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f895f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595f5c is the less saturated color, while #05b362 is the most saturated one.
